Rhode Island General Laws 23-64.1-7. Race, ethnicity, social determinants of health and language data collection coordination

The commission shall, in consultation with the department of health and other appropriate state agencies, make recommendations for data collection, analysis and dissemination activities by all entities involved in the collection of patient and health care professional information. The commission shall make recommendations for the coordination by the department of health, other agencies, organizations and institutions as needed to design and implement a training curriculum for primary data collectors and disseminate best practices for collection of race, ethnicity, social determinants of health and language data.
History of Section.
P.L. 2011, ch. 155, § 2; P.L. 2011, ch. 172, § 2.
